Facundo Monteseirín is a 31-year-old football player who plays as a defender for Union San Felipe, born on 12. März 1995. Follow Facundo Monteseirín on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Facundo Monteseirín's career has also included time at CD Unión San Felipe II, Union San Felipe, CA Chaco For Ever, Nueva Chicago, Tigre, San Martin San Juan, Lanus, and Arsenal Sarandi.

On the international stage, Facundo Monteseirín has represented Argentina U20.

Throughout their career, Facundo Monteseirín has won 5 titles: Super Copa International (2016/2017), Copa Sudamericana (2013), Liga Profesional (2016), and Copa Bicentenario (2016) with Lanus and CONMEBOL U20 Championship (2015 Uruguay) with Argentina U20.
